Output db52a605f9b9c376a79fadf7805046f1572379d76f8b848feea5ea2c1f749355:15

value
7334694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d605f3be7a609474b603590d221c21eb3e2f9bf OP_EQUAL
address
3ACkDRoeVS1gMnQ1APVQemBoA3vCcCMk4s
transaction
db52a605f9b9c376a79fadf7805046f1572379d76f8b848feea5ea2c1f749355
confirmations
229395
spent
true